Noble Biomaterials teams up with Lenzing for new textiles

18/07/2017
Textile technology provider Noble Biomaterials has partnered with cellulosic fibre producer Lenzing to create a range of high-performance textiles that use Noble’s silver-based anti-odour technology. 

The collaboration will offer activewear brands “a more natural textile alternative to polyester”, Noble has said. It added that the two companies will be able to “provide an optimum textile blend for active-lifestyle applications that can be washed less frequently and maintain freshness.”

“Lenzing and Noble share a rich history in fibre and textile development, and a deep commitment to sustainability,” explained Joel Furey, founder and chief commercial officer of Noble. “We also share a vison of consistently innovating new textiles and technologies that improve people’s lives every day.”

Lenzing will introduce the new fabric collections at the forthcoming Texworld USA exhibition in New York City (July 17-19).
